What Are Governmental Approvals?

Governmental approvals refer to the formal permissions issued by government bodies allowing certain actions or projects to proceed legally. This encompasses zoning variances, building permits, environmental clearances, and other regulatory consents necessary under Michigan law. These approvals ensure compliance with legal standards and community expectations before construction or business operations commence.

Key Elements and Steps in Securing Governmental Approvals

The process typically begins with identifying the required permits based on the project scope in Auburn Hills. Next, detailed applications must be prepared, often including technical reports or plans. Submissions are then reviewed by the relevant agencies, which may involve public hearings or environmental reviews. Finally, once all conditions are met, approvals are granted, allowing the project to proceed.

Glossary of Important Terms Related to Governmental Approvals

Understanding key terminology helps navigate the governmental approval process effectively. Below are some commonly used terms you may encounter during your project in Auburn Hills.

Zoning

Zoning refers to local laws that regulate land use and development within specific areas to maintain orderly growth and community character. It determines what types of buildings and activities are permitted in Auburn Hills neighborhoods.

Permit

A permit is an official authorization issued by a government agency allowing you to carry out a particular activity, such as construction or land use, in compliance with applicable laws.

Environmental Impact Assessment

This assessment evaluates the potential environmental consequences of a proposed development to ensure that negative effects are minimized or mitigated as required by law.

Variance

A variance is a relaxation of zoning rules granted by local authorities to allow a property owner to use land in a way that would otherwise be prohibited under existing regulations.

Yes, property owners in Auburn Hills can apply for variances if their project does not conform to existing zoning regulations. The variance process involves submitting an application and demonstrating that strict compliance would cause unnecessary hardship. Public hearings and agency review are typically part of this process. Legal assistance can help prepare a strong variance application and represent your interests during hearings to improve the likelihood of approval.
